Transaction 4efbcfa9716ead82bc934034038c9a7ab8839dc12e0b7a23d85a8e0f2f33a751
1 Input
1 Output
-
4efbcfa9716ead82bc934034038c9a7ab8839dc12e0b7a23d85a8e0f2f33a751: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84f535abf7bde26aaf8df0cca9c89dd44a90c844628ce9c0392c43515e907b46
- address
- bc1psn6nt2lhhh3x4tud7rx2njya639fpjzyv2xwnspe93p4zh5s0drqnrzmsv